[News] Donghae and Siwon to promote in Taiwan for 6 hours
2011.11.11
“Extravagant Challenge”, starring Korean boy group Super Junior’s Donghae and Siwon is set to premiere in the middle of December. Due to their concerts and year-end award shows, the two stars will only be in Taiwan for six hours to promote the drama.
Donghae and Siwon are expected to be at the “Extravagant Challenge” press conference on December 14th. They will return to Korea on the same day to attend an award show without having time for rehearsal.
“Extravagant Challenge” is filled with SJ flavor, with the opening theme song, “Extravagant Solo”, sung by Super Junior-M. Donghae will also showcase his composing talent; he especially wrote a song based on his character in the drama and will be singing it in Chinese.
Both Donghae and Siwon spoke in Korean during the filming. It has been decided that former Energy member Kun Da will dub Siwon’s voice. Donghae’s Chinese voice is still to be determined.
